CVE-2025-47816
libpspp-core.a in GNU PSPP through 2.0.1 allows attackers to cause an spvxml-helpers.c spvxml_parse_attributes out-of-bounds read, related to extra content at the end of a document.
CRITICAL 9.1EPSS 0.34%
Does this matter?
High impact if exploited, but EPSS currently rates exploitation as unlikely (0.34%). Schedule it in the normal patch cycle and watch for a rise in EPSS or a public exploit.
